
Philippe Clement makes delusional Rangers claim as pressure mounts on Russell Martin
Rangers’ winless start to the William Hill Premiership season has left Russell Martin on the brink of the sack.
Martin continues to face pressure from fans, whilst Andrew Cavenagh has said that the board will continue to back the former Southampton manager.
With a crucial Premier Sports Cup quarter-final against Hibs coming up, Martin will surely be sacked if the Light Blues are eliminated from the competition they have won a record 28 times.
Former Rangers manager Philippe Clement has made a controversial claim regarding his time in G51, as Martin’s future at the club remains on a knife-edge.

Philippe Clement claims he was well-liked by Gers fans
Clement spoke to Belgian Media outlet GVA about how he was sacked at Rangers.
Clement said: “I sometimes find it hard to put that out of my mind, because the circumstances in which something like that happens aren’t always known to the outside world, and that’s why it’s hard for me to call it dismissal.
“The trick is to see through it. I may have joined those clubs at the wrong time. But I’m still well-liked in Monaco and Glasgow because they know the work I’ve done.”
This statement isn’t exactly accurate, as Rangers fans wanted Clement gone long before he was eventually sacked in February.

Whilst Clement has a much better record at Rangers, albeit over a longer period of time, he wasn’t the most popular manager to have taken charge at Ibrox.

Philippe Clement remained deeply unpopular with rangers fans
Clement was sacked following a 2-0 loss to St. Mirren in Fenruary, with Barry Ferguson taking over as an interim manager for the rest of the season.
- Eliminated from the Champions League playoffs following a 3-1 aggregate loss to Dynamo Kyiv
- Lost the 2024/25 Premier Sports Cup final to Celtic on penalties
- At the time of his sacking, Rangers were 13 points behind Celtic
Clement did manage to win a piece of silverware at the club by beating Aberdeen in the Premier Sports Cup final in 2023.
Ultimately, Russell Martin is far more unpopular with fans than Clement ever was; however, his claim that he was ‘well-liked’ is simply inaccurate and delusional, as he failed to close the gap on arch-rivals Celtic.
